"It was a girl.

One of my sisters.

Now, which one, I wonder?
and why did she run?
I do not care to catch her.

It is no sport playing with girls." So little curiosity did he have in the matter, that he did not follow on the track of the fugitive, nor even go to the window to look out; but, walking up to the sideboard, he opened it to take the water-pitcher and get a drink.
As he did so, he started.

There stood the basket of fruit which Saveria had filled so carefully with fruit for his uncle the canon.
